[Spice-devel] [spice-gtk PATCH v2] Usbredir: enable lz4 compression

Snir Sheriber ssheribe at redhat.com
Sun Apr 10 14:24:23 UTC 2016


Compressed message type is CompressedData which contains compression
type (1 byte) followed by the uncompressed data size (4 bytes) followed
by the compressed data size (4 bytes) followed by the compressed data

If SPICE_SPICEVMC_CAP_DATA_COMPRESS_LZ4 capability is available &&
data_size > COMPRESS_THRESHOLD data will be sent compressed otherwise
data will be sent uncompressed (as well if compression has failed)
